Russia entry requirements for Senegal passport holders
Senegalese passport holders need a visa to enter Russia. Apply at a Russian embassy or consulate before you travel — there is no visa-on-arrival or e-visa option as of 2026. Processing takes 2–4 weeks, so plan ahead.
Entry requirements
| Requirement | Details | Status |
|---|---|---|
| Visa application Apply at the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s | You need a visa before you fly. Apply at the Russian MFA visa portal — the link is below. Processing takes 5–10 business days for a standard tourist visa. You will need a visa support letter (voucher) from a Russian tour operator or hotel.Apply for visa | Required |
| Valid passport Must cover your entire stay in Russia | Your passport must be valid for the full duration of your stay. Russia does not enforce a 6-month validity rule — just cover your travel dates. Airlines may still check for at least 6 months, so carry your visa approval letter as backup. | Required |
| Return or onward ticket Required for visa application and at border control | You need a confirmed return or onward ticket to show at the visa interview and at passport control. Russian immigration officers check this strictly. A flight reservation from a travel agent works for the visa, but have a real ticket for entry. | Required |
| Proof of accommodation Visa support letter or hotel booking | Your visa application requires a visa support letter (voucher) from a Russian tour operator or hotel. This is part of the visa process — you cannot skip it. Carry a printed copy of the voucher and hotel booking confirmation when you travel. | Recommended |
| Proof of funds Show you can cover your stay | Immigration may ask for proof of funds — have a bank statement or credit card showing at least $500–$1,000 for a short trip. Russian officers rarely ask, but carry a printout just in case. | Recommended |

Transiting through Russia
Senegal passport holders need a transit visa to change planes in Russia, even if staying airside. Apply at a Russian consulate before travel.
- Holders of valid diplomatic or service passports may be exempt.
- Crew members with valid documents may transit without visa.
